Fast-fashion recycling: how β€˜the castoff capital of the world’ is making Indian factory workers sick Reports of lung disease, skin conditions and even cancer are rising in Panipat, which recycles 1 million tonnes of textile waste a year

β€œworking environment is insufferable… We routinely come across cases of breathing issues, migraine, skin infections, even cancer.… risks are even higher in bleaching & dyeing units, where labourers handle toxic chemicals eg sulphuric acid with their bare hands.”

The government must ensure fair distribution of income 'The average real wage of workers has hardly moved from the 2008 level whilst bosses never had it so good.'

The state we're in

UK full-time employee median wage, Β£30,816.
4.5m jobs pay less than the real Living Wage.
1.17m workers on zero-hour contracts.
34% of Universal Credit claimants are in work.
16m Britons live in poverty.

Can't build economy on poverty.

Must increase worker share of GDP.
